Applications in Diagnostics
Purine nucleoside analogs can serve various roles in diagnostic kits. They might be used as substrates, cofactors, or components in amplification or detection systems. Their specific molecular structure allows for targeted interactions, enhancing the specificity and sensitivity of tests.
